How do you replace the CR2450 Battery
The BMW key fob is a convenient device that provides security and convenience at the click of the button. However, over time, the battery in your BMW keyfob can be damaged, and need to be replaced for it to work effectively. Knowing how to replace the BMW key fob will assist you in getting back to the road again quickly and quickly.
Although there are a variety of kinds of BMW key fobs most use the same battery type that is a CR2450 or CR2032 coin cell. This small, round battery can be often found in shops and can be bought for less than a dollar per unit. In addition to being readily available, CR2450 batteries are also very easy to install and remove from the key fob.
To replace the CR2450 batteries in your bmw keys replacement, locate the tab that releases the metal valet inside the fob. Once the metal valet key is removed, search for an access port that is small on the front of the fob that conceals the key battery cover. Utilizing a flat screwdriver remove the cover and reveal the battery. Install a new battery with the positive side facing up, and then reassemble your key fob.
Once the new battery is installed Test the key fob to confirm that it functions properly. Contact your BMW dealer if the key fob isn't responding. Some older BMW models require that the key fob be re-synchronized with the vehicle after changing the battery. However, this is not the case for BMWs made in recent years.
Although it is possible to change the battery in an older BMW key fob by cutting open the case and putting to a new battery, this is not recommended since it could damage the internal circuit board.
